NASCAR 2002 Patch Released
- Posted 10:21 AM By Squirre1
EMail News to a Friend  Printer Friendly Version    0 Comments | Add 
Sierra's NASCAR 2002 has just recently had a patch released for it... The patch, version 1.1.0.1, has quite a few corrections to it. If you click on the Read More link, you can see a complete list of all the fixes. Or you can get right to downloading here.

Nvidia NV30 Due in August?
- Posted 7:23 AM By Kagato
EMail News to a Friend  Printer Friendly Version    0 Comments | Add 
While Jen-Hsun Huang, Nvidia CEO, did not mention the chip by name, it was noted that they will be releasing a new chip in august. Not alot of info on the new toy, but they do have this to say:
The new chip will be manufactured on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Co.'s latest 0.13-micron manufacturing process, Huang said. Huang did not reveal the name or specific features of the chip, but did say it was a fundamentally new architecture from the GeForce 4 Titanium introduced earlier this year.
Guess we'll have to see what they have in store for gamers this time around. I imagine more information will become available as the NDAs expire.
 
Nvidia WinXP Refresh Rate Tool
- Posted 7:29 AM By Kagato
EMail News to a Friend  Printer Friendly Version    0 Comments | Add 
A great deal of you have probably switched you're main gaming rig over to Windows XP, or at least dual-boot it with Win98. One annoyance you may have found with XP is in the way the refresh rates in DirectX and OpenGL games defaults to 60hz. This can be changed, but requires a bit of modification to the registry. Fortunately some blokes have sat down and started work on a new tool that allows you to tweak the refresh rates to take better advantage of your monitors/LCDs capabilites. The program is still in it's infancy, so be sure to check the NVRefreshTool homepage as updates come on a nearly daily basis as they hammer out bugs in the software.

FLF 1.5a Talk
- Posted 3:03 PM By Curve
EMail News to a Friend  Printer Friendly Version    0 Comments | Add 
Was reading over at Planet Half-Life when I came across news of Front Line Force's latest "in the works" Here's a sample of what to expect in the next release:
  • Hitbox fixes (wow! they're perfect!)
  • MSG-90's damage has been increased
  • SAKO now does damage in accordance with how many teammates are near you - .667x of it's base damage with 0 teammates to 1.5x with 3 teammates
  • Shotguns will be slightly "off center" (the center of the spread will be off center) while running, and more off center while jumping
  • New teamicons
  • Key-cap gameplay HUD elements (make it easier to see what's going on)
  • New polished up versions of flf_sogem, flf_ebonysword
  • Go read more at the Front Line Force website.

    EverQuest II
    - Posted 3:28 PM By Curve
    EMail News to a Friend  Printer Friendly Version    0 Comments | Add 
    You like the MMORPG's don't you? I thought you did. GameSpot has the latest scoop of Sony Online's 'in the works' sequel to the ever popular MMORPG EverQuest, EverQuest II. Here's a crispy, crunchity, peanut buttery tidbit:
    Sony Online Entertainment has announced EverQuest II, the upcoming sequel to its groundbreaking massively multiplayer online role-playing game EverQuest. The new game will improve on its predecessor with a completely new 3D engine, new spells, quests, and events, and the option for characters to own real estate and command ships. It will also include a new branching character class structure, more customization options, and a new nonconfrontational character advancement system for new classes such as the tradesman.

    EverQuest II will be set in Norrath, the gameworld featured in the original game, but it will take place during the Age of Destiny, a period in the future of the original game's gameworld. The game engine will support significantly more detailed environments and advanced graphics features such as per pixel lighting, dynamic environment mapping, and a programmable surface shader system. In addition, the game will have completely new combat, spell, and skill systems and a revised quest system.
    I'm not a big fan of the MMORPGs, however if that floats your boat, check it out.

    Kiddie Games Only?
    - Posted 9:39 AM By Anthos
    EMail News to a Friend  Printer Friendly Version    0 Comments | Add 
    A bill introduced in Congress last week would make it a federal crime to sell or rent violent video games to minors.

    US Representative Joe Baca, D-California, introduced a bill in Congress last week that would make it a federal crime to sell or rent violent video games to minors. The Protect Children from Video Game Sex and Violence Act of 2002 would apply to games that feature decapitation, amputation, killing of humans with lethal weapons or through hand-to-hand combat, rape, carjackings, aggravated assault, and other violent felonies. Twenty-one other representatives cosponsored the bill, which was referred to the House Judiciary Committee.

    Terabyte Hard Drives On Their Way?
    - Posted 3:48 PM By Kagato
    EMail News to a Friend  Printer Friendly Version    0 Comments | Add 
    Are you one of those people who have a growing collection of MP3s (or pr0n) growing on your drive and find that todays 120Gig drives just aren't enough storage?! Well, fear not, for Fujitsu has the answer for your storage capacity woes. Granted they say the technology is several years from being mainstream, it still sounds tasty:
    San Jose, Calif., May 08, 2002 - Fujitsu, a world leader in hard disk drive technology, has developed revolutionary new read head and media technologies that will enable hard disk drive (HDD) recording densities of up to 300 gigabits per square inch (Gb/in²). The new technologies are expected to lead to the commercial introduction within two to four years of 2.5" hard disk drives with capacities up to six times the recording density available today.
    I'm thinking 4 of these drives (4 platters in each drive), stripped up in RAID 0 would ofer some uber storage capacity.

    Creative/3DLabs Merger Approved
    - Posted 10:13 AM By Anthos
    EMail News to a Friend  Printer Friendly Version    0 Comments | Add 
    3DLabs shareholders approved the proposed acquisition of the company by Creative Technology (makers of the SoundBlaster & 3D Blaster line of multimedia PC products) in a vote that took place on May 9, 2002 in Bermuda. The Company also announced that the Supreme Court of Bermuda had granted a final order approving the scheme of arrangement by which 3Dlabs will be acquired by Creative. Creative will acquire all of 3Dlabs' outstanding shares and 3Dlabs will become a wholly owned subsidiary of Creative. 3Dlabs shareholders will receive U.S. $1.20 per share, plus stock equal to 0.205 of an ordinary share of Creative. This whole shooting match should be completed by the end of the week, according to both companies.

    Sierra Announces Empire Earth Expansion
    - Posted 3:40 PM By Anthos
    EMail News to a Friend  Printer Friendly Version    0 Comments | Add 
    Sierra on Thursday announced the development of its first expansion for Empire Earth. In development at Mad Doc Software and due in stores this fall, Empire Earth: The Art of Conquest expands the scope of the real-time strategy game into the future - allowing for planetary conquest. The add-on offers a new Space Age Epoch that covers the time period from 2200 to 2300 A.D. and adds three new single-player campaigns, unique units, buildings and special powers.

    Art of Conquest includes three new single-player campaigns set in ancient Rome, the Pacific Theater and Asia in the 24th century. Each of the 21 pre-designed civilizations in the game also gains a unique special power, building or unit. One example is the Kingdom of Italy's Metallurgy power - which allows them to pay building costs with gold or iron interchangeably. Great Britain's S.A.S. unit will be able to plant demolitions and swim across water, while the United States' market building will allow that civilization to trade abundant resources for scarce ones.

    GameCube Joins The Cutback League
    - Posted 3:01 PM By Kagato
    EMail News to a Friend  Printer Friendly Version    0 Comments | Add 
    It's amazing what a company will do when their other two major competitors decide to drop THEIR systems down to $199. You go from "We will not be lowering our prices" to "Now only $149!". I've always wondered if cases like these are becuase of one hand not knowing what the other is planning or they just don't wanna leak the news too soon (i.e. milk the customer for as much extra cash as possible). Either way, what I'm hinting at is that according to this article on CNN, Nintendo of America will be cutting the price on a brand spankin' new GameCube to just $149. You gotta love console pricewars, who knew it'd be a good thing for the consumer. Word:
    LOS ANGELES, California (AP) -- Nintendo of America announced Monday it will cut the price of its GameCube video game system by $50 to $149, the latest shot in the ongoing console war that includes Sony's PlayStation 2 and Microsoft's Xbox.

    Nintendo's new price, effective Tuesday, followed drops last week in the consumer cost of its two rival systems. PlayStation 2 and Xbox were both selling for $299 before separate announcements that the companies were reducing the prices to $199.
    Now if they could only get some more worthwhile titles for the system (i.e. Hurry up with Metroid!).

    Sony CD + Black Marker = Copy Away
    - Posted 6:41 PM By Kagato
    EMail News to a Friend  Printer Friendly Version    0 Comments | Add 
    Well, this one falls into the realm of "I don't condone this, but for those who like to copy". Apparently Sony's "Key2Audio" technology (i.e. the CD copy protection that prevents you from ripping tracks) has been defeated by a simple black felt tip marker. Here's a snip from the story:
    LONDON, May 20 (Reuters) - Technology buffs have cracked music publishing giant Sony Music's (Tokyo:6758.T - News) elaborate disc copy-protection technology with a decidedly low-tech method: scribbling around the rim of a disk with a felt-tip marker.

    Internet newsgroups have been circulating news of the discovery for the past week, and in typical newsgroup style, users have pilloried Sony for deploying "hi-tech" copy protection that can be defeated by paying a visit to a stationery store.
    Perhaps one of the funniest things about the whole incident is from an alt.music.prince.read poster (I didn't realize people still use Newsgroups) who asked "I wonder what type of copy protection will come next?Maybe they'll ban markers."

    Project Entropia
    - Posted 8:30 PM By WaRMaN
    EMail News to a Friend  Printer Friendly Version    0 Comments | Add 
    Project Entropia, a MMORPG which is slated to release in the future, is being tagged as a great money making oppurtunity.

    Gamers will have the ability to use PE Dollars (PED) to buy items needed in the game. Three PEDs are the equivalent of one US Dollar. PEDs can be purchased with USDs for use on the game server. Therefore gamers that invest USDs into the game for PEDs can in-turn buy real estate with their PEDs and rent out virtual lots to vendors in hopes of making USDs. Sound familiar? OMG see the article!

    XBox is Going LIVE
    - Posted 9:19 PM By WaRMaN
    EMail News to a Friend  Printer Friendly Version    0 Comments | Add 
    Microsoft Corp. became the first video game company ever to announce a comprehensive online game service fully dedicated to fast-action, always-connected broadband gaming experiences. The online console gaming service, named Xbox Live, launches in the US, Japan and Europe this fall for the Xbox video game system and ramps up with consumer beta programs starting this summer.

    Xbox Live will enable all gamers to find their friends easily; talk to other players during game play through the Xbox Communicator headset; download current statistics, new levels and characters to their Xbox hard drive; and play online.

    Midway Games Goes PCS Wireless
    - Posted 2:38 PM By WaRMaN
    EMail News to a Friend  Printer Friendly Version    1 Comment | Add 
    Sprint, which operates the largest all-digital, all-PCS nationwide wireless network, and Midway Games announced that Midway plans to take some of its most popular games mobile as it develops wireless games for Sprint's Third-Generation (3G) PCS Phones. These 3G games will include versions of popular titles such as Defender, Kick Champion and Mahki that will be developed using the Java 2 Platform, Micro Edition (J2ME).

    For Sprint customers, 3G1X services are planned to launch nationwide this summer. After the launch, Sprint expects faster wireless data speeds and enhancements for existing applications and services when using a 3G enabled device. It also establishes a platform for later releases of new and more robust applications as data speeds increase including enhanced games, video and audio clips, enhanced messaging, email with attachments, high-speed Internet browsing and digital imaging. Specifically for games, 3G enables Sprint to move the game experience from the text-based games of today to graphic, full-color brand name games on 3G-enabled PCS Phones using the J2ME platform. I wonder if Mortal Kombat is in the near future as well?
